In viscous fluid services in Tacaimbó, the FBE works where centrifugals lose efficiency: gear volumetric efficiency improves with viscosity, covering up to 100,000 SSU and 350 °C with a heating jacket — the typical case of óleos e água industrial. The design counterpart is mandatory — a discharge line protected by a relief valve, because positive displacement does not tolerate blockage.

The FB portfolio handles an extensive spectrum of fluids. The FBE series takes mineral and synthetic oils, asphalt (CAP), BPF fuel oils, petroleum derivatives, molasses, resins plus viscous chemical and hydraulic products; the FBCN series works with raw and treated water, process fluids and industrial effluents; the FBOT series is dedicated to thermal oil at elevated temperatures. Each case is sized considering viscosity, temperature and chemical compatibility.

Four families are manufactured in Cabreúva/SP: external gear FBE and internal gear FBEI for viscous fluids, standardized centrifugal FBCN for low-viscosity liquids and FBOT for thermal oil circuits up to 350 °C. Fire-fighting systems per NFPA 20 / NBR 16704 complete the line.
Maximum temperature depends on the series: FBE and FBEI operate up to 350°C with heating jacket and special sealing; FBOT operates up to 350°C in thermal oil circuits; FBCN operates up to 260°C with proper materials and sealing. Correct sizing of sealing and materials is essential for safe operation.

In a normalized centrifugal retrofit, ASME B73.1 requires that units of the same standard dimension designation, from any source of supply, be interchangeable as to mounting dimensions, suction and discharge nozzles, input shaft and foundation bolt holes.
